Bay Tree Standard

Bay Trees have glossy evergreen aromatic foliage and small yellow flowers in spring.  A bay tree is a must have shrub for cooks.  Hardy in all except the coldest winters. Sun or part shade, well drained soil or grow in pots of John Innes Compost In a 7.5 litre pot, trained as a standards with 1.2m stems including pot and well formed ball of foliage on top of this height, foliage diameter approx. 30cm Specially selected for having the straightest stems available. Olive Tree Quarter Standards 'Olea europea'

Olive Trees are evergreen which are ideal for growing in pots on the patio. This olive tree will produce fruit in hot summers. Feed often in growing season. Olive Trees can survive most winters outside provided they are in full sun, well drained soil & a sheltered spot. In cold areas keep in a pot so they can be brought inside during prolonged spells of freezing weather. Photinia 'Red Robin' - Half Standard

Photinia Red Robin is an evergreen shrub with dark green, glossy foliage. The young foliage is a very eye catching bright red. Prune often to keep bushy & encourage new bright red foliage. Photinia Red Robin prefers sun or part shade, any fertile soil OK.
